The “Babale” file, is postponed again the trial for Salianji

The hearing session in the Appeal for MP Ervin Salianji regarding the Babale case is postponed again. Journalist Ermal Vija reports that the next session will be held on June 12 at 10:30. Salianji filed a motion to postpone the trial due to a business trip to Indonesia. Last time, the session was postponed after […]
